New Delhi - It is the capital city of India

History Channel Documentary 2015,New Delhi - It is the capital city of India. It has been the seat of numerous kingdoms. It is an antiquated city having heaps of landmarks, sanctuaries, and workmanship and design attractions with different attractions to offer its guests. The city appreciates pride with three UNESCO World Heritage Monument Sites. They are Red Fort (a standout amongst the most rich mughal landmarks in India), Qutub Minar (the longest block and stone minaret on the planet) and the Humayun's Tomb (an excellent greenery enclosure tomb worked by Humayun's dowager Hamida Begum).

Other worth going by attractions of New Delhi city visits are Rashtrapati Bhawan (President House), Sansad Bhawan (Parliament of India), Old Fort (Purani Quila), India Gate (a forcing Ware Memorial with beautiful greenery enclosures in surroundings), Bahai House of Worship (Lotus Temple), Laxmi Narayan Temple (Birla Temple), Mughal Gardens, Gardens of Five Senses, Buddha Gardens, ISKON Temple, Lodhi Gardens, and so on.
